1 Samuel 2:11-13
Holman Christian Standard Bible
11 Elkanah went home to Ramah,(A) but the boy served the Lord in the presence of Eli the priest.(B)
Eli’s Family Judged
12 Eli’s sons were wicked men;(C) they had no regard for the Lord(D) 13 or for the priests’ share of the sacrifices from the people. When any man offered a sacrifice, the priest’s servant would come with a three-pronged meat fork while the meat was boiling

1 Samuel 2:11-13
New International Version
11 Then Elkanah went home to Ramah,(A) but the boy ministered(B) before the Lord under Eli the priest.
Eli’s Wicked Sons
12 Eli’s sons were scoundrels; they had no regard(C) for the Lord. 13 Now it was the practice(D) of the priests that, whenever any of the people offered a sacrifice, the priest’s servant would come with a three-pronged fork in his hand while the meat(E) was being boiled
